Objective
The CORTEX project will investigate architectures for the ubiquitous, decentralised, and proactive mission-critical computer systems of the future. The project results will enable new applications in key areas such as intelligent vehicles and robots, traffic and telecommunications management, process control and C3. The CORTEX approach is based on the sentient object concept: mobile intelligent software components that sense the environment, and discover and interact with each other and with the environment. Sentient objects demand predictable and guaranteed quality of service (QoS) in the timeliness and reliability domains. CORTEX will: design a programming model supporting incremental real-time and reliability guarantees; design an abstract network model handling heterogeneity and hierarchy of networks; develop protocols and services to support sentient objects; evaluate the results by demonstration.
OBJECTIVES
We are now at the point where the emergence of a new class of applications that operate independently of direct human control can be envisaged. Future mission-critical computer systems will be comprised of networked components that will act autonomously in responding to a myriad of inputs to affect and control the surrounding environment. Key characteristics of these applications include sentience, autonomy, large scale, time and safety criticality, geographical dispersion, mobility and evolution. The key objective of CORTEX is to explore the fundamental theoretical and engineering issues necessary to support the use of sentient objects to construct large-scale proactive applications and thereby to validate the use of sentient objects as a viable approach to the construction of such applications.
DESCRIPTION OF WORK
CORTEX will:
- Design a programming model that supports the development of applications constructed from mobile sentient objects including:
a) development of an appropriate object model and communication paradigm that will build on recent results concerning large-scale communication support by exploiting paradigms like zoning and topology awareness to allow the heterogeneity of the underlying infrastructure to be accomodated while allowing reliable communication and consensus to be achieved;
b) development of means to express QoS properties in the model, where QoS is taken as a metric of predictability in terms of timeliness and reliability;
c) development of a global model for QoS assurance.
Design an interaction model for co-operating sentient objects. This model will centre around an anonymouns generative communication abstraction reflecting the needs of an event-based computational model including object autonomy and system evolution.
Design an open, scalable system architecture that reflects the heterogeneous structure and performance of the networks used to support the programming model.
This will entail:
a) develop abstract network models to describe the properties of underlying networks;
b) recognising the hierarchical structure of the network topology, by considering the underlying network infrastructure as a WAN-of-CANs;
c) develop the protocols and services required to support the desired functional and non-functional properties of sentient objects.
Develop one or more demonstrators to allow the technology to be assessed.
Fields of science (EuroSciVoc)
CORDIS classifies projects with EuroSciVoc, a multilingual taxonomy of fields of science, through a semi-automatic process based on NLP techniques. See: The European Science Vocabulary.
CORDIS classifies projects with EuroSciVoc, a multilingual taxonomy of fields of science, through a semi-automatic process based on NLP techniques. See: The European Science Vocabulary.
- natural sciences computer and information sciences software
- natural sciences mathematics pure mathematics topology
- engineering and technology electrical engineering, electronic engineering, information engineering information engineering telecommunications telecommunications networks
You need to log in or register to use this function
We are sorry... an unexpected error occurred during execution.
You need to be authenticated. Your session might have expired.
Thank you for your feedback. You will soon receive an email to confirm the submission. If you have selected to be notified about the reporting status, you will also be contacted when the reporting status will change.
Programme(s)
Multi-annual funding programmes that define the EU’s priorities for research and innovation.
Multi-annual funding programmes that define the EU’s priorities for research and innovation.
Topic(s)
Calls for proposals are divided into topics. A topic defines a specific subject or area for which applicants can submit proposals. The description of a topic comprises its specific scope and the expected impact of the funded project.
Calls for proposals are divided into topics. A topic defines a specific subject or area for which applicants can submit proposals. The description of a topic comprises its specific scope and the expected impact of the funded project.
Call for proposal
Procedure for inviting applicants to submit project proposals, with the aim of receiving EU funding.
Data not available
Procedure for inviting applicants to submit project proposals, with the aim of receiving EU funding.
Funding Scheme
Funding scheme (or “Type of Action”) inside a programme with common features. It specifies: the scope of what is funded; the reimbursement rate; specific evaluation criteria to qualify for funding; and the use of simplified forms of costs like lump sums.
Funding scheme (or “Type of Action”) inside a programme with common features. It specifies: the scope of what is funded; the reimbursement rate; specific evaluation criteria to qualify for funding; and the use of simplified forms of costs like lump sums.
Coordinator
1749-016 LISBOA
Portugal
The total costs incurred by this organisation to participate in the project, including direct and indirect costs. This amount is a subset of the overall project budget.